Royal Hideaway is def the most high end. I've heard nothing but incredible things about it but it is $$. I got a sick deal at Secrets Capri a few months after the swine flu scare. I loved it there. Excellence is really good too - I've been to the one in the DR, but not Mexico.

we went here on our honeymoon...the pools were beautiful, the rooms nice, the food good... however there was no beach... I was really disappointed with that because the pictures on their web site made it look like a beach... but it was really a lagoon type thing... i really wanted a beach where I could just dig my feet into the sand...
